Output 18da853ea14907e901cc4ccb2ec28e7ca3012b9e5dd1f7d5ad5075ce32e1f115:12

value
21141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307d20c9bbafa0f3cec72e54dd358eb23151d650 OP_EQUAL
address
367QFoXDxaQ35iJSbjd5eTLR5Rii649qTy
transaction
18da853ea14907e901cc4ccb2ec28e7ca3012b9e5dd1f7d5ad5075ce32e1f115
spent
true